Ordinals
beta
Address bc1qmc6z6cfpju2xq02g5t0var0f34xkz93mjzqd2h
sat balance
15365
runes balances
outputs
1ff6d180cc78dc441782d360017f3ecf6480271a2fc92a6aac23bcd4be8edda5:8